AI Summary
- Creates a Senate Study Committee on Universal Design Incorporation Within State Buildings to assess current accessibility and usability of state buildings and recommend ways to implement universal design principles such as automated doors, varying-height water fountains, curb cuts, and levered door handles
- Committee comprises 9 members appointed by the President of the Senate: 3 senators and 6 nonlegislative members with expertise in universal design, architecture, engineering, disability services, and 2 representatives from the Georgia State Financing and Investment Commission
- Committee is charged with studying conditions, needs, and issues related to universal design in state buildings and recommending any necessary action or legislation
- Final report with findings and proposed legislation must be approved by majority vote and filed with the Secretary of the Senate no later than December 1, 2024, at which point the committee is abolished
- Funding for the committee comes from Senate appropriations, with member allowances capped at 5 days unless additional days are authorized
